Dale E. Hedman

MONTREAL, Wis. – Dale Edward Hedman, 69, a longtime resident of Montreal, passed away peacefully on Tuesday, July 16, 2024, with his family at his side.

Dale was born on Sept. 21, 1954, in Ironwood, Michigan, a son of Oiva E. and Frances M. (Moncher) Hedman. He graduated from J.E. Murphy High School in Hurley. Dale continued his education at Gogebic Community College and earned an Associate Degree.

Dale was employed at White Pine Copper Mine until its closure and concluded his working career as a mine safety inspector at MSHA.

Dale proudly served his country in the U.S. Army and for many years was in the Army Reserves. He was honorably discharged as a staff sergeant.

Dale was a supporting member of the Hurley American Legion Post 58, and a dedicated member of the Hurley Lions Club.

Dale looked forward to watching his grandson, Dominic, play in many baseball games. His passion was to socialize with his family and friends.

Survivors include two daughters, Jaclyn and Kayla; his former wife, Joan Koski; two cherished grandchildren, Dominic and Dylan; two brothers, Darryl (Kathy) and Peter (Dori); a niece, Sara (Jon); a nephew, Jacob (Alina); and several aunts, uncles and cousins.

He was preceded in death by his parents; a granddaughter, Lilly Alana Sivula; and a sister, Marian.
